    Another place for lunch in Jalan Alor is this kopitiam known as Restaurant Beh Brothers. At night this kopitiam serve Thai “Dai Chow” and Bak Kut Teh. In the afternoon there are two stalls is well known to many lunch patrons which is the noodle shop in this coffee shop and also Indonesian Economy rice right behind it.

    It is one of the 100s of restaurants on Jalan Alor which is known for Chinese restaurants. As soon as you enter the street, you are hit by a barrage of smells coming out from all the different restaurants. Beh Brothers is situated very near to the 7-eleven on the street. We ordered multiple dumplings, mostly with pork and sea food and Pad Thai. Most of the dumplings were very nice. The portion size was a bit small with just 3 dumplings in each dish. Really enjoyed the pork buns. Most of the places on Jalan Alor also serve beer which makes it an even more pleasurable experience.

    A restaurant that is also found in Jalan Alor, this place is pretty much okay, food is just right. We had dimsum and Tiger beer, which makes it my first time trying it – not bad. There was a bit of confusion with the servers when we asked for the receipt but all in all, it is an okay restaurant, one you can go to when you are near Jalan Alor and is especially craving for dimsum.

    One of the many restaurants in Jalan Alor which basically caters to tourists. They serve Thai food and has a good selection of Dimsums. The beer was cheaper than couple of other outlets around. The food and service was average and nothing extraordinary like all the other restaurants in Jalan Alor. What makes it worth is the street musicians who comes and plays around you. They are really good and it adds a lot to the whole atmosphere.
